AI Summary
-
Prohibits private entities (homeowners associations and community associations) from restricting installation, maintenance, or use of roof-mounted solar energy systems on single-family dwellings.
-
Applies to dwellings where the owner is responsible for roof maintenance, repair, replacement, and insurance.
-
Allows private entities to require licensed contractor installation, ensure systems don't extend above roof peaks, require indemnification for damages, list the entity as certificate holder on insurance, and mandate system removal if needed for common element repairs.
-
Permits reasonable restrictions that do not decrease energy generation by more than 20 percent or increase costs by more than 20 percent for solar water heaters or $2,000 for solar photovoltaic systems.
-
Requires solar energy system applications be processed like architectural modifications with written approval or denial within 60 days; applications are deemed approved if not denied within that timeframe.
